Our competences
ACCIONA's selection process for various competences is designed to identify in candidates the set of skills, attitudes and knowledge that different jobs require.
Our competences are based upon four areas of good performance: results, imagination, people and influence. Get to know them better!
Results-oriented
Ability to focus an activity upon achieving objectives that bring value to ACCIONA.
Organization and planning
Know how to identify, assess and programme the actions that must be carried out to achieve a specific end, how to carry them out and what resources are needed to meet the final objective.
Quality management
Understand procedures and comply with, disclose and master them through action and by example. Also concerns the need to update knowledge.
Customer-oriented
Sensitivity, attitude and commitment in helping both internal and external clients.
Business vision
The ability to imagine where ACCIONA’s efforts and resources should be directed through a global, integrated vision of the market, the competition and the Company’s strategy.
Initiative and innovation
Act in a proactive way, anticipating needs, identifying opportunities and assuming calculated risks. Introduce, in a productive way, new and creative approaches to activities, work processes and products, as well as improving existing work plans.
Flexibility and willingness to change
Capacity to modify our own methods, by accepting changes to adapt to and anticipate new contexts, through a proactive attitude.
Teamwork
Collaborating with people inside and outside the team, establishing efficient working relationships and fluid communications which help to meet objectives.
Leadership and team development
Behaviour directed at motivating, developing and leading the team towards the assigned objectives, establishing the most appropriate level of delegation for each professional depending upon their maturity, experience and independence.
Communication
Ability to express ideas in a clear and convincing way, as well as developing listening habits to be receptive to proposals from others.
Contact networks
Capacity to establish, maintain and develop the achievement of business objectives through contacts and professional networks.
Negotiation
Know how to convince and arrive at agreements, being able to establish lasting relations both with the Company’s own employees and suppliers and/or external clients.
